Communist China identified as greater threat than Russia in the Canadian Arctic

The Epoch Times: 'Many of the Chinese activities in and around the Arctic have dual-use purposes and could be used to advance China’s strategic and military interests. [China] views itself erroneously as a ‘near-Arctic state,’” said Kevin Hamilton, director general of international security policy at Global Affairs Canada.


'He and other defence professionals and Arctic specialists were testifying before the Senate Standing Committee on National Security and Defence on March 21 at a hearing to “examine and report on issues relating to security and defence in the Arctic.”


'Major-General Michael C. Wright, commander of the Canadian Forces Intelligence Command and chief of defence intelligence, said “there are many areas of convergence [between China and Russia], but I would say there are also areas of divergence and it is an unequal partnership—Russia very much the junior partner, and that will be increasingly so over the coming years.”'
